在用pip安裝Package的時候
常常會有一些火星文出現
再用pip list時又查不到希望安裝成功的套件
那除了利用安裝錯誤訊息外,還有什麼方法可以安裝呢?
PIP install遇到困難,那...換個方法吧!
首先,先到Package 的網站 or git下載.gz檔案下來
另外還要看一下網站描述是否有支援您的python版本<-這也滿重要的
接著,在gz檔裡會提供一個setup.py 的檔案,確定下載下來的整包有這個檔案後
將整包放到python.exe的路徑下, 方便等下直接執行setup.py檔案
Step1. 開啟cmd
Step2.到可以執行py檔的路徑下(也就是有python.exe路徑下)
Step3.cd 到setup.py的路徑下
Step4.build setup.py檔案
語法:python setup.py build
Step5.利用setup.py檔案開始案裝Package
語法:python setup.py install
Step6.檢查是否安裝成功
語法:pip list
有時去找pip install 安裝的錯誤訊息是很花時間的
如果初步看錯誤訊息不太懂的話(ex:ssl error....)
大可先試試直接下載Package的install 安裝包(.gz)
手動作下載動作...
參考資料:
Error: No Commands supplied when trying to install pyglet-stack overflow
[Python] pip install SSL Error 解決方法